
Popular History of France from the Earliest Times vol 1
by François Pierre Guillaume Guizot
'Popular History of France from the Earliest Times vol 1' Summary
François Guizot's 'Popular History of France' is a comprehensive and engaging account of French history from its earliest beginnings to the 16th century. It delves into the various periods of France's past, examining the rise and fall of dynasties, the evolution of society and culture, and the impact of major historical events. Guizot's writing is clear, concise, and informative, making this book accessible to both general readers and students of history. The book's narrative style, combined with Guizot's insightful analysis, offers a vivid and thought-provoking exploration of France's rich and complex history.Book Details
